 
				
				
			
			 
									
									Northumberland County Council has installed a solar car port array to help provide clean energy for its headquarters at County Hall in Morpeth
The £3.8m project, which includes a covered parking area with a canopy made from photovoltaic (PV) panels, has been designed and built by UK Power Network Services.
The 40-year-old staff car park has undergone major refurbishment work, which provided a timely opportunity for the council to?upgrade its energy.
